The Power Behind Your Smart Lock

Most residential smart locks are designed with one primary consideration for their core functionality: independent power. Unlike many smart home devices that rely solely on your home’s main electrical supply, the vast majority of smart locks are battery-powered locks. This design choice is fundamental to their smart lock reliability and ensures they continue to operate even when your Wi-Fi is down or the neighborhood loses power.

Ensuring Smart Lock Reliability During Blackouts

When Ottawa experiences a power disruption, you can generally rest assured that your smart lock will continue to function. Here’s why:

  • Internal Battery Power: Your smart lock uses AA, AAA, or a specialized battery pack. This independent power source enables the motor, keypad, and internal electronics to operate without external electricity.
  • Low Battery Warnings: Modern smart locks are equipped with indicators (audible alerts, flashing lights, or app notifications) that warn you well in advance when the battery is running low, giving you ample time to replace them. This proactive notification is key to maintaining smart lock reliability.
  • Decentralized Operation: The core locking and unlocking mechanism, as well as the keypad, often function locally. This means they don’t necessarily need an active internet connection or your home’s router to work. While some advanced features (like remote monitoring or voice assistant integration) might be temporarily unavailable without Wi-Fi, the fundamental ability to lock and unlock your door remains.

Smart Lock Backup: Your Layers of Power Outage Safety

Beyond the primary battery power, leading smart lock brands incorporate various smart lock backup features to guarantee power outage safety and ensure you’re never truly stranded:

  • Traditional Key Override: This is arguably the most important backup. Nearly all smart locks come with a traditional physical keyhole. In the event of a complete battery failure or an unresolvable electronic issue, your existing house key will still work, just like with a standard deadbolt.
  • 9V Battery or USB Jumpstart: Some smart lock models feature external contacts where you can temporarily connect a 9V battery or a portable USB power bank. This provides enough juice for a quick code entry, allowing you to get in and then replace the internal batteries.
  • Physical Keypad (Battery-Dependent): Even the keypad itself is battery-powered, so you can still enter your code to unlock the door. Just remember, a drained internal battery will affect both the motor and the keypad.

What Ottawa Homeowners Should Know

Given Ottawa’s climate and occasional power fluctuations, considering smart lock performance during outages is a valid concern. Here’s what KeyItLocks recommends for maximum peace of mind:

  • Regular Battery Checks: Make it a habit to check your smart lock’s battery status via its app or physical indicator every few months.
  • Have Backup Keys: Always know where your traditional backup key is, whether with a trusted neighbor or in a secure, accessible location.
  • Test Backup Methods: Periodically test the key override or 9V jumpstart feature (if your lock has it) to ensure you’re familiar with its operation.
